    5 years ago i bought a blade, when i got back from the test ride on that my wife was sitting on a gen 3 Daytona and she ended up buying that. Everytime i took her Daytona out i absolutely loved the bike, the noise is just so addictive, the whistle, the induction roar but the pops and bangs on the overrun just made me want to keep opening and closing the throttle. Skip forward to this summer unfortunately due to health she cant ride anymore, so I sold my blade and bought her Daytona, it's the best move i've made, absolutely love the bike and other than a straight line i'm faster point to point on the Daytona. Love these bikes.
